Quantitative Genetics
1 allele
2 alleles
X alleles
For any trait:
Total variance = genetic variance + environmental
variance
Or
VT = VG + VE
V
G
Heritability =
VG + VE

Artificial Selection - Drosophila geotaxis
Selection of
positively and negatively
geotactic Drosophila
Artificial selection
- mating speed in Drosophila
Fast maters
Control
First half of
maters
Slow maters
Second half of
maters
Repeat for 25 generations
Got three distinct lines
Fast - 3 mins
Control - 5 mins
Slow - 80 mins
